But what exactly is flame retardant MDF? This type of medium-density fiberboard is treated with fire-resistant chemicals to increase its resistance to flames. Designed for use in environments where safety is critical, such as commercial spaces, schools, and hospitals, flame retardant MDF serves as an important preventative measure against fire hazards.
Why do industries opt for flame retardant MDF? The primary purpose is to reduce the risk of fire related incidents. In settings where the safety of occupants is a top priority, the use of flame retardant materials can mean the difference between a contained incident and a catastrophic event. The application scenarios for flame retardant MDF are diverse. In commercial settings, it is often used for wall panels, furniture, and ceiling tiles. For example, an office interior designed with flame retardant MDF wall panels not only looks aesthetically pleasing but also meets fire safety regulations. Similarly, in the hospitality industry, hotels can use this material for furniture and fixtures, ensuring that both comfort and safety coexist.
In educational institutions, classrooms built with flame retardant MDF can significantly enhance safety measures, protecting students and faculty in case of fire-related emergencies. Another crucial application is in the manufacturing of cabinetry, where flame retardant MDF is used to make fire-rated cabinets that can store hazardous materials safely.
